CVE-2026-65706

FFmpeg 3.0 - 8.1.2 vf_swaprect Out-of-Bounds Write via NV12 Frame Processing

Published: 7/23/2026 Last updated: 7/28/2026 Reserved: 7/22/2026

FFmpeg versions 3.0 through 8.1.2 contain an out-of-bounds write vulnerability in the vf_swaprect video filter that allows attackers to corrupt heap memory by supplying a crafted NV12 video frame with odd width dimensions. The filter_frame() function reuses a temporary row buffer sized for plane 0's single-byte pixel step across all planes, causing an 18-byte memcpy into a 17-byte heap allocation when processing the two-byte-per-sample interleaved chroma plane of a 17x16 NV12 frame, resulting in heap corruption and process crash with potential for code execution.
